motor replacement

does the transmission and transfer case have to be removed to pull the engine from a 97 ford f 150 4x4 with a 4.2 v6 engine?

Re: motor replacement

I would recommend unbolting the transmission from the engine block then unboltin the torque converter and sliding the transmission and transfer case back so as to allow the engine to clear the transmission.

If I"m not too lat to chime in...remove the hood. Not necessary for v-8s, (and yes they can come out the top without removing the body) but the 4.2 you have to. I dented two hoods before I got it through my thick skull.
